The code SKF - 6106 indicates a Conrad design bearing. This designation is significant because the Conrad design allows for the rolling elements (the balls or rollers) to remain contained within the bearing, which facilitates smooth rotation and improved efficiency. In this design, there are typically two raceways, and the rolling elements are not full complement; rather, they are precisely arranged to fit within the designated space, taking advantage of a single row of rolling elements.

The significance of recognizing a Conrad design lies in its application; it’s commonly used in various machinery and equipment, providing a balance of load-carrying capacity and operational speed. Understanding this component of bearing design enables a better grasp of bearing application, performance characteristics, and maintenance requirements.
